Cesar Chavez Health Services Center
Community Health Clinics in Detroit, Michigan.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) school-based service delivery site in Detroit, Wayne County. FQHCs are HRSA Section 330 grantees that provide comprehensive primary care, preventive services, behavioral health, and enabling services on a sliding-fee scale regardless of insurance status or ability to pay.
